Optical proximity sensor and eye tracker
Description
A user interface system, including a display surface displaying thereon a plurality of controls representing different applications, a multi-faceted housing situated along a single edge of the display surface, including an eye-tracker mounted in a first facet of the housing, the first facet being distal from the display surface, the eye-tracker identifying a control on the display surface at which a user's eyes are directed, and a proximity sensor mounted in a second facet of the housing, the second facet being between the first facet and the display, the proximity sensor detecting a gesture performed by an object opposite the second facet, and a processor running the different applications, connected to the proximity sensor and to the eye-tracker, causing the application represented by the control identified by the eye-tracker to receive as input the gesture detected by the proximity sensor.
